Our verdict is Uncertain significance. Variant got 2 ACMG points: 2P and 0B. PM2

The NM_018320.5(RNF121):​c.565T>C​(p.Tyr189His) variant causes a missense change involving the alteration of a con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
RNF121 (HGNC:21070): (ring finger protein 121) The protein encoded by this gene contains a RING finger, a motif present in a variety of functionally distinct proteins and known to be involved in protein-protein and protein-DNA interactions. Several alternatively spliced transcript variants have been noted for this gene, however, not all are likely to encode viable protein products. [provided by RefSeq, Sep 2008]

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sJan 03, 2022The c.565T>C (p.Y189H) alteration is located in exon 6 (coding exon 6) of the RNF121 gene. This alteration results from a T to C substitution at nucleotide position 565, causing the tyrosine (Y) at amino acid position 189 to be replaced by a histidine (H).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
